First, let’s define what block rewards are. In the Bitcoin network, miners are responsible for verifying transactions and adding them to the blockchain. As a reward for their work, miners receive newly created bitcoins. This is known as the block reward, and it serves as an incentive for miners to continue verifying transactions and securing the network.

Another potential use case is facilitating secure and transparent payments between healthcare providers and patients. Currently, healthcare payments can be slow and cumbersome, involving multiple intermediaries and high transaction fees. Bitcoin’s decentralized nature and low transaction fees make it an attractive option for healthcare payments. Additionally, the transparent nature of the blockchain ensures that all transactions are recorded and can be easily audited, reducing the risk of fraud and errors.

Blockchain technology and Bitcoin can also be used to improve the supply chain management of medical equipment and pharmaceuticals. Counterfeit drugs and medical equipment are a major problem in the healthcare industry, and blockchain technology can help address this issue. By using blockchain technology to track the movement of medical equipment and pharmaceuticals, healthcare providers can ensure that they are receiving genuine products and that they have not been tampered with. This can help improve patient safety and reduce the risk of harm from counterfeit products.
